Pumpkin soup is a fall classic that is both delicious and nutritious. But what if you don’t have time to make it fresh? Can you make pumpkin soup ahead of time?

The answer is yes! You can make pumpkin soup 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ator for up to 3 days, or in the freezer for up to 3 months. This makes it a great option for busy weeknights or for when you’re entertaining guests.

How to Make Pumpkin Soup Ahead of Time

To make pumpkin soup ahead of time, simply follow these steps:

1. Roast the pumpkin until tender.
2. Scoop the flesh out of the pumpkin and into a blender.
3. Add the remaining ingredients to the blender and blend until smooth.
4. Transfer the soup to a container and refrigerate or freeze.

How to Store Pumpkin Soup

Pumpkin soup can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days, or in the freezer for up to 3 months. To store the soup in the refrigerator, simply transfer it to an airtight container. To store the soup in the freezer, transfer it to a freezer-safe container.

How to Reheat Pumpkin Soup

To reheat pumpkin soup, simply thaw it overnight in the refrigerator, or heat it up on the stovetop over medium heat. You can also microwave the soup on high for 2-3 minutes, or until heated through.

Can I use canned pumpkin to make pumpkin soup?

Yes, you can use canned pumpkin to make pumpkin soup. However, fresh pumpkin will give the soup a richer flavor.

How can I thicken pumpkin soup?

You can thicken pumpkin soup by adding a cornstarch slurry. To make a cornstarch slurry, mix 1 tablespoon of cornstarch with 2 tablespoons of water. Add the cornstarch slurry to the soup and cook over medium heat until the soup has thickened.

Can I freeze pumpkin soup?

Yes, you can freeze pumpkin soup. To freeze the soup, transfer it to a freezer-safe container. The soup will keep in the freezer for up to 3 months.
